We have some very sad news to share.

Last night, Elizabeth Jean Rivera was struck by a car, as she walked across East Broad Street, in Bethlehem. She was taken to St. Luke’s Hospital and died of multiple blunt force injuries.

We're feeling the loss, and are in shock over it. Those of us knew who Liz each had a unique relationship with her. Many of you met her, here at the bakeshop, or out in the community. She had no home, but found places to keep herself safe at night. We started most days together, as she came in daily for tea and conversation. She especially enjoyed our quiche, soup, zucchini bread, and mac and cheese.

She laughed a lot, and she sure did complain about people who asked her too many private questions, but mostly she just wanted to belong to the community. In recent years, she spent most of her time on a bench on Broad Street, where she made crafts to support herself. She wanted to be self-sufficient, she valued her dignity, and I think we all respected that.

We have lots of stories about Elizabeth, and we’ll remember her fondly, as a person in our community.

Rest in peace, dear lady. We will miss you.
